Living & Working in Sylvania

Sylvania, Ohio: A Thriving Hub for Nursing Professionals Amidst Growing Healthcare Demand and Community Spirit

Sylvania cityscape

Nestled in the heart of Ohio, Sylvania is a vibrant city known for its lush parks, friendly community, and a rich tapestry of culture that reflects both history and modern living. Our town is a growing hub for healthcare, where several facilities provide ample opportunities for nursing professionals. As a resident here, I often hear from colleagues about the increasing demand for healthcare services that support our aging population. Currently, the average salary for registered nurses in Sylvania tends to range from $60,000 to $75,000 annually. In comparison, according to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the national mean salary for registered nurses is about $77,600, while Ohio figures hover around $66,240, suggesting that we're slightly above the state average but still below the national benchmarks. With our close proximity to Toledo and its larger healthcare networks, we benefit from a robust nursing job market that resonates with the rhythm of city life—complete with picturesque streets and community events that celebrate our local spirit.

The pace in Sylvania lets me focus on what matters—my patients and my growth.

The nursing job market in Sylvania is witnessing steady growth, with demand reflecting a larger national trend towards needing more healthcare professionals, particularly in acute care settings. NurseRecruiter estimates that our city currently employs around 800 nurses, with projections indicating that we will need approximately 150 to 200 additional nurses over the next few years to meet rising healthcare standards and population needs. The demand for travel nursing positions here can fluctuate, especially during flu season and summer months, as healthcare facilities often seek short-term staffing solutions. While Sylvania may not be recognized as a central hub for travel nursing compared to cities like Cleveland or Columbus, we see a steady influx of per diem roles that allow for flexible staffing across our various hospitals, clinics, and nursing homes. Notable employers include Flower Hospital and the ProMedica Sylvania Campus, both providing diverse nursing roles that cater to various specialties, including emergency care and pediatrics. Adjacent cities, like Toledo, boast larger hospitals and potentially more job opportunities, but they also carry a higher cost of living and a more bustling lifestyle.

In terms of healthcare infrastructure, Sylvania is seeing continuous improvement, with recent investments aimed at enhancing our local facilities and expanding services, especially in telehealth and mental health. The community spirit thrives amidst our local parks and family-friendly events, offering a balance between professional commitment and quality of life. With a population just over 19,000 and projected growth fueled by young families and a number of educational initiatives, Sylvania is shaping its healthcare landscape to support its residents effectively. Our public health initiatives aim to promote wellness and preventive care, keeping everyone informed and engaged in their health journey. Do I need to be licensed in Ohio to work in Sylvania?
Good news! Ohio is a member of the eNLC (Enhanced Nurse Licensure Compact). You can practice here with a compact license from any member state.
